Lev-Tolstovsky District (Russian: Лев-Толсто́вский райо́н) is an administrative and municipal district (raion), one of the eighteen in Lipetsk Oblast, Russia. It is located in the north of the oblast. The area of the district is 970 square kilometers (370 sq mi). Its administrative center is the rural locality (a settlement) of Lev Tolstoy. Population: 17,141 (2010 Census); 17,862 (2002 Census);17,748 (1989 Census). The population of Lev Tolstoy accounts for 50.5% of the district's total population.
